Phillies Acquire International Pool Money From Orioles

By Jeff Todd | March 18, 2019 at 5:42pm CDT

The Phillies and Orioles have announced a swap in which the Philadelphia organization acquires international bonus pool spending availability. Young catcher Lenin Rodriguez is heading to Baltimore in return.

This is the latest in a strong of transactions in which the O’s have spun off international spending capacity. The club missed on some top targets and obviously felt unable to put its remaining funds to productive uses.

Rodriguez, who’ll soon turn 21, has not seen much game action in the lower minors since signing for a $300K bonus. Over the past four seasons, he’s a .263/.369/.367 hitter in 444 plate appearances — more than half of which came in Venezuelan Summer League ball way back in 2015.

        This current allotment of international money expires on July 2. The Orioles, even after the past few trades, have a higher allotment than every other team. Almost all of the promising international free agents have signed; only one, Yolbert Sanchez, is still available. Sanchez is an elite defender but limited offensively so there is no rush to sign him for any significant bonus money.

        Also, a little research shows that there is a possibility that in the next few months Cuban players may be able to sign as free agents without defecting, meaning more players will become available that currently are not.
